Strength & Conditioning

Key Principles of Strength & Conditioning for Endurance Performance - with Dr Richard Blagrove

Richard has a wealth of experience in Sports Science, Physiology and athletic performance and is currently Senior Lecturer in Physiology and Programme Leader for the MSc Strength and Conditioning at Loughborough University. Richard is also the author of 'Strength and Conditioning for Endurance Running' which was published in 2015.

Navigating Endurance Training and Performance through the Menopause - with Dr Nicky Keay

Dr Nicky Keay is a medical doctor with specialist expertise in the field of exercise endocrinology (she's an expert in hormonal health!) and has many years experience working in clinical and athletic fields.

Her research into the impacts of lifestyle, nutrition and exercise on hormone networks is regularly published and she is the author of "Hormones, Health & Human Potential" and editor of “Myths of Menopause”.
